Highlights • Private hot tub • Large fenced backyard • Cozy gas stove • Smart TV • Fully equipped kitchen • 15 minutes to Heavenly Resort • 20 minutes to Sierra-at-Tahoe • Walk to Tahoe Paradise Park & Lake Baron • Close to hiking, biking, golf & year-round recreation Things To Know Tahoe is home to many animals. You may experience bears, raccoons, mice, and other animals. Meadows are home to many rodents. When these areas are filled with water or snow, these animals move to homes in the area. You may experience these animals in or near your home. WiFi can be spotty in the mountains. This home is not equipped with air conditioning. Parking is limited to 2 vehicles in the driveway only.
